“Hate Being Punched in the Kisser” – Dwayne ‘The Rock’ Johnson Almost Left His Wrestling Career Behind for MMA

Dwayne Johnson is one of the biggest celebrities in the world. He initially made his name at WWE. Although the start of his career wasn’t great, he soon became one of the most popular superstars on the roster.

He was excellent on the mic and had some of the best catchphrases in WWE history. Johnson is considered one of the biggest WWE stars of all time, and he had some amazing rivalries throughout his time there. His popularity hasn’t gone down since leaving the company and he still is a fan favorite.

But there was a time in his career when he almost quit professional wrestling and made a switch to MMA. In his initial years in the company, Johnson wasn’t having the best time and considered going to Japan. However, he quickly realized that it wasn’t for him.

In a tweet, he said, Fun for journalist to dream up the scenarios if I had competed in @ufc (there was a point in 1997 where I considered going to Japan to train to begin an MMA career when my wrestling career was failing miserably). Realized quick I actually hate being punched in the kisser.

Johnson recently appeared on UFC Live on ABC. When was asked about his thoughts about competing in the UFC, he said, “I would’ve gotten my face smashed in and I like my jaw where it’s at.”

Dwayne Johnson and UFC sign a huge deal

Johnson, since leaving the WWE, has involved himself in different projects. He is one of the biggest celebrities in the world and a huge fan of the UFC. Johnson has made multiple appearances on UFC events.

‘The Rock’ was present for the BMF title fight between Jorge Masvidal and Nate Diaz.

Now, the actor and the MMA promotion have taken their relationship a step further. Dwayne Johnson’s footwear brand, Project Rock, in association with Under Armour, has signed a global partnership deal with the UFC. The fighters will wear Project Rock footwear for their walkouts during the UFC 270 event.

 The Rock said, “UFC athletes are amongst the greatest, toughest, focused, most disciplined and hardest training athletes on the planet. I am proud, grateful and humbled that my innovative Project Rock training shoe is now the official global footwear partner of the UFC.”
